Ordinals
beta
Sat 1990535396557016
decimal
909713.84057016
degree
0°69713′497″84057016‴
percentile
94.78739994031457%
name
tddvxwmvuf
cycle
0
epoch
4
period
451
block
909713
offset
84057016
timestamp
2025-08-12 16:26:53 UTC
rarity
common
prev
next